Abstract

BACKGROUND

Respiratory muscle training (RMT) has shown potential for enhancing athletic performance, but its effectiveness, in youth wrestlers, remains unclear. This study aimed to investigate the effects of RMT on respiratory muscle strength and aerobic endurance in youth wrestlers.

METHODS

A parallel-grouperal was conducted across 22 male youth wrestlers aged 14.8 ± 0.4 years. Participants were assigned to an experimental(E) group (n = 11), which received RMT in addition to their regular wrestling training, or a control(C) group (n = 11), which continued with standard wrestling training only. The RMT was performed three times a week using the POWERbreathe Classic Blue® device at 50% of maximal inspiratory pressure (MIP). Pre- and post-intervention measurements included MIP, peak inspiratory flow (PIF), inspiratory volume (IV), and aerobic endurance assessed by the Yo-Yo Endurance Level 1 test (YYT).

RESULTS

Significant improvements were observed in the E group, with MIP increasing by 9.57%, PIF by 14.77%, and IV by 10.46% (p < 0.05 for all). Aerobic endurance, as measured by VOmax and total running distance, also significantly improved by 4.93% and 8.22%, respectively (p < 0.05). The C group showed smaller yet significant gains in MIP, PIF, and VOmax but no significant change in IV.

CONCLUSION

The addition of RMT to traditional wrestling training significantly enhances respiratory muscle strength and aerobic endurance in youth wrestlers. These results suggest that RMT may be an effective complementary training method to improve athletic performance in this population.

摘要

背景

呼吸肌训练(RMT)已显示出增强运动表现的潜力,但在青少年摔跤运动员中的有效性仍不明确。本研究旨在调查RMT对青少年摔跤运动员呼吸肌力量和有氧耐力的影响。

方法

对22名年龄在14.8±0.4岁的男性青少年摔跤运动员进行了平行分组试验。参与者被分配到实验组(E组,n = 11),除了常规摔跤训练外,还接受RMT训练;或对照组(C组,n = 11),仅继续进行标准摔跤训练。使用POWERbreathe Classic Blue®设备,以最大吸气压力(MIP)的50%每周进行三次RMT训练。干预前后的测量指标包括MIP、吸气峰值流量(PIF)、吸气量(IV),以及通过Yo-Yo耐力水平1测试(YYT)评估的有氧耐力。

结果

E组观察到显著改善,MIP增加9.57%,PIF增加14.77%,IV增加10.46%(均p < 0.05)。通过最大摄氧量(VOmax)和总跑步距离测量的有氧耐力也分别显著提高了4.93%和8.22%(p < 0.05)。C组在MIP、PIF和VOmax方面有较小但显著的增加,但IV没有显著变化。

结论

在传统摔跤训练中加入RMT可显著增强青少年摔跤运动员的呼吸肌力量和有氧耐力。这些结果表明,RMT可能是提高该人群运动表现的一种有效补充训练方法。
